Although porosity can often be forgotten, it continues to be an essential concern in welding that can jeopardize the integrity of an ended up item. Porosity describes the presence of tiny gas pockets within the weld grain, which can compromise the joint and lead to premature failure. This trouble usually arises from impurities, moisture, or inappropriate shielding gas protection throughout the welding procedure. To minimize visit site porosity, welders need to confirm that the base materials are clean and completely dry, utilize ideal securing gases, and maintain constant welding criteria. Frequently inspecting the devices and atmosphere can likewise aid identify prospective issues before they manifest in the weld. Attending to porosity efficiently is necessary for achieving strong, resilient welds that meet high quality requirements.
Irregular Weld Beads
Irregular weld beads can greatly affect the high quality and stamina of a finished item. Various elements add to this issue, including inappropriate travel speed, wrong amperage settings, and inconsistent electrode angles. When the welder moves as well promptly, a grain may show up narrow and do not have penetration, while relocating also gradually can cause too much buildup. In addition, utilizing the incorrect amperage can result in either damaging or excessive spatter, both of which compromise weld stability. The welder's method, such as irregular torch motion, can additionally cause irregular bead appearance. To minimize these troubles, welders should concentrate on maintaining consistent, regulated movements and ensuring proper tools settings to attain harmony in their welds.
